John Madden first became a household name as the head coach of the Oakland Raiders. He led the team to a Super Bowl victory in 1976. Known for his passionate leadership and keen football insights, Madden inspired players and fans alike. After retiring from coaching, he became an influential broadcaster, celebrated for making the game accessible and exciting for millions of Americans.
Madden's popularity soared further thanks to the groundbreaking Madden NFL video game franchise. His name became synonymous with football in homes across the country, ensuring his influence would continue for decades.
The legend of John Madden is set to be explored like never before in the upcoming film, simply titled Madden. Directed by Oscar-nominated filmmaker David O. Russell, the movie places Nicolas Cage in the lead role as Madden himself, while Christian Bale plays Raiders owner Al Davis. The casting has already generated significant buzz, raising expectations for an authentic and compelling portrayal.

The Madden biopic boasts a star-studded cast beyond just Cage and Bale. John Mulaney joins as Trip Hawkins, the founder of Electronic Arts, while Kathryn Hahn portrays Virginia Madden and Sienna Miller appears as Carol Davis. The screenplay builds on early drafts by Cambron Clark, ensuring the film offers both entertainment and authenticity.
